
Scalextric was great fun as a kid but let’s be honest, it didn’t really require much in the way of skill… all you did was press the button then watch as your cars zipped around the track and you hoped that yours would cross the finish line fastest. Ultimately it came down to dumb luck (although there are some angry nerds out there who would be pretty angry at that insinuation).
This new Wave Racers from Auldey Toys changes that however by putting acceleration firmly in the users’ hands. The speed of the car here depends on how fast kids can wave their hands over the top of cars. It looks like tiring work though it’s hopefully good forearm exercise and practice for when they’re older!
